**Checklist item 7 — Image cache leak (Petalbox 3.4).** Confirm the fix for the thumbnail cache leak in the Petalbox gallery module. Previous builds failed to evict decoded bitmaps after the carousel unmounted, growing memory by roughly 4 MB per session. Run the soak script for 30 minutes and verify heap stays flat. If you're new: the soak harness lives in the tools repo. Verify the fix against the build stamped with the token below.

session token of tajef-bageg = htk21_5d90d574934f3ccae6437

## Tuning the import wizard

A quick note for the security review: the Parchwell CSV wizard is deliberately paranoid. Every upload is size-capped, row-capped, and sniffed for formula-injection patterns before parsing starts, and anything that smells like a zip bomb gets bounced. Yes, that means some legit giant files fail — customers can split them. If you want to loosen or tighten anything, these are the only knobs that matter.

tuning constants:
TIERS = {
    "sorion": 670,
    "istax": 547,
}

## Break-Glass: Sproutly Scheduler

If the Sproutly watering scheduler wedges and greenhouse pumps at Dellwick go dark, reviewers with break-glass rights can bypass the approval queue. Use it sparingly — every use pings the whole team. The emergency admin vault opens with the recovery passphrase below.

vault phrase of yawig-bawig = fenael-norael-eliox-gilox-casath-druath-zorys-istwyn-jorwyn

## Crumbwell order-cutoff rule

Orders placed after 16:00 local roll to the next bake day. The cutoff job runs at 16:05 and flags late orders; if it fails, bakers see yesterday's queue. Restart with `cutoffd --rerun` — idempotent, safe to repeat. Config is in `/etc/crumbwell/.env`: `CUTOFF_HOUR=16`, `CUTOFF_TZ` per site. The job also authenticates to the order ledger, and that credential goes on the next line:

env line for bageg-yahog: RELAY_SECRET13=e7aee444c36a0